==History==

Lung was originally a member of a Chinese gang, of which several members were powered. However, after an encounter with [[Contessa]], every member of the gang except for Lung was killed. Lung would have died as well, his face pushed into a block of an unidentified drug, had he not triggered.

Lung fought [[Leviathan]] at some point before the events of the story. While he lost, for a time he was sufficiently powerful to hold his own in both durability and offensive power.
 
Lung later arrived in Brockton Bay, where he amassed a gang of every local Asian, including several powered lieutenants. For a long time, his gang was the most powerful in the area.
 
During [[Taylor|Skitter's]] first night out as a cape, she encountered and fought Lung. While she was unable to defeat him, she inflicted a massive amount of damage to him, and he was taken prisoner by [[Armsmaster]], where the sedatives placed on him suppressed his regenerative abilities.
 
He later appeared during the Hive arc, in a far more powerful form. He easily defeated Sundancer, Kaiser, and Menja, but was once again defeated by Skitter, this time using a catterpillar soaked in hallucinogenic fluids from [[Newter]]. Upon his defeat, he was sent to the Birdcage.
 
As his first act in the Birdcage, he killed Bakuda to prove himself too unstable to be bothered by other inmates. Despite this, he formed a bond, if not friendship, with [[Marquis]].
 
When the Birdcage was opened to bring out the inhabitants as reinforcements against Scion, he was one of them who took part. His powers let him hold his on for a while, but were not enough to do serious damage.
 
In the epilogue, his last known status is as a mercenary in the service of Teacher.
==Trigger Event==
Lung triggered March 2nd 1997 after being forced to ingest a lethal amount of powdered drugs by a woman whose description matches [[Contessa ]] (at the time acting as a bodyguard to another woman matching [[Doctor Mother]] 's description).
 
==Powers and Abilities==
 
Lung's power can be charged up for a period of time, and then released during a fight. Over the course of the expenditure of his power, Lung undergoes a number of physical changes, such as armor, claws, a tail, and even wings during later stages. He is also an extremely powerful regenerator, and a pyrokinetic whose ability increases as the rest of his powers do.
